Greek Word Study · Strong’s G1721

ἔμφυτος

emphutos · “implanted/ingrafted

Used 1 times across 1 book

Definition
ἔμ-φυτος, -ον
(ἐμφύω, to implant), [in LXX: ἔ. ἡ κακία αὐτῶν, Wis.12:10 * ;]
1. innate (Wis.12:10).
2. rooted, implanted: Jas.1:21 (see Mayor, in l).†
